Stainless steel is one of the most commonly used materials in rapid prototyping for steel castings because of its excellent corrosion resistance, mechanical performance, and wide range of industrial applications.
Common stainless steel grades used for prototype castings include:
304 stainless steel
304L stainless steel
316 stainless steel
316L stainless steel
304 and 304L stainless steel provide good corrosion resistance and reliable mechanical properties, making them suitable for general industrial components and equipment parts.
316 and 316L stainless steel offer improved corrosion resistance due to the addition of molybdenum. These materials are often selected for applications involving chemicals, saltwater environments, and other corrosive conditions.
Using stainless steel in rapid prototyping for steel castings allows engineers to test components under conditions closer to actual production environments. This helps verify whether the selected material can meet performance expectations before large-scale manufacturing begins.
